Hints for adjusting the parameters (STR-DE1015G)

•Wall material simulation (WALL)

When sound is reflected off soft material, such as a

curtain, the high frequency elements are reduced. A

hard wall is highly reflective and does not significantly

affect the frequency response of the reflected sound.

The WALL parameter lets you control the level of the

high frequencies to alter the sonic character of your

listening environment by simulating a softer (SOFT), or

harder (HARD) wall. The midpoint designates a neutral

wall (made of wood).

Adjusting surround sound parameters(except for delay time)

Adjust the surround sound parameters to fit your

listening situation. See the charts “Adjustable sound

parameters . . .” on pages 37 and 38 for parameters you

can adjust in each sound field.

1While playing a component, click SOUND in the

main menu to display the SOUND FIELD

SELECT menu.

2Click a sound field genre, then click MODE
repeatedly until the mode you want appears.
3Click SUR.
